CRUISE SHIP THROUGH THE THOROUGH WEB PROVIDERS HANDBOOK FOR A DEEP STUDY COMMUNICATION PROCEDURES, CORE IDEAS, AND FINEST METHODS-- YOUR PORTAL TO MASTERING INTERNET SERVICES WAITS FOR

Cruise Ship Through The Thorough Web Providers Handbook For A Deep Study Communication Procedures, Core Ideas, And Finest Methods-- Your Portal To Mastering Internet Services Waits For

Cruise Ship Through The Thorough Web Providers Handbook For A Deep Study Communication Procedures, Core Ideas, And Finest Methods-- Your Portal To Mastering Internet Services Waits For

Blog Article

Content Author-Cotton Fulton

Discover the ultimate Web Providers Manual for all your needs. Check out interaction protocols, core principles of SOAP and REST, and finest practices for seamless implementation. Discover the keys to grasping internet services, from comprehending the essentials to executing scalable design. Master the art of creating secure systems and optimizing for future development. Unlock the power of web solutions at your fingertips.

Summary of Internet Providers



If you have actually ever before questioned what internet solutions are and how they work, this review is the excellent location to start. Internet solutions are a way for various applications to interact with each other online. They allow for smooth assimilation of systems, making it easier to share data and capabilities.

Among the essential aspects of web services is their use of conventional procedures like HTTP and XML to assist in communication. This standardization makes sure that various systems can understand and interact with each other effectively. Internet solutions can be categorized right into 2 primary types: SOAP (Simple Object Access Procedure) and REST (Representational State Transfer).

SOAP is a method that makes use of XML for message exchange, while remainder depends on conventional HTTP methods like obtain, PUBLISH, PUT, and erase. Both have their strengths and are made use of in various scenarios based on requirements.

Key Ideas and Technologies



Checking out the fundamental concepts and technologies of internet solutions is crucial for understanding their performance and application in modern systems. When diving right into the vital ideas and innovations of web solutions, you unlock to a world of interconnected possibilities. Below are some essential elements to comprehend:

- ** SOAP (Simple Things Access Procedure) **: This procedure defines the structure of messages traded between internet services.
- ** WSDL (Internet Providers Summary Language) **: WSDL is made use of to explain the performances supplied by an internet solution.
- ** REMAINDER (Representational State Transfer) **: An architectural design that uses typical HTTP approaches for communication between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ical role in data exchange in between web solutions as a result of its versatility and readability.

Comprehending related internet page and innovations will lay a solid foundation for your journey right into the realm of web services.

Best Practices for Application



To guarantee effective implementation of web services, prioritize adherence to best techniques. Begin by thoroughly documenting your web solution APIs, including clear descriptions of endpoints, specifications, and expected actions. Regular naming conventions and versioning of APIs are essential for maintainability. When developing https://holdenpfwmc.loginblogin.com/36565544/by-adhering-to-these-actions-you-ll-increase-your-opportunities-of-locating-the-right-electronic-advertising-and-marketing-business-to-help-your-organization-prosper-in-the-affordable-on-the-internet-landscape , adhere to the concepts of remainder to develop a scalable and adaptable architecture. Carry out appropriate authentication and consent devices to safeguard your services, such as OAuth or API keys.

Examining is essential in making sure the integrity of your internet solutions. Create thorough test cases that cover numerous situations, consisting of positive and negative testing. Constant integration and automated testing can assist capture concerns early in the advancement process. Screen your web solutions in real-time to identify performance traffic jams and potential failures. Logging and error handling are crucial for identifying issues and repairing problems successfully.


Lastly, think about the scalability of your web solutions deliberately for future growth. Apply caching mechanisms and tons harmonizing to deal with enhanced traffic. Consistently evaluation and maximize your code for performance. By adhering to these best practices, you can simplify the application of internet solutions and ensure their success.

Final thought

Congratulations! You have actually simply opened the key to understanding web solutions. By understanding the essential ideas and technologies, and implementing best practices, you're well on your method to ending up being a web services professional.

Keep discovering and trying out what you have actually found out to proceed expanding your knowledge and abilities in this interesting field.

The globe of internet solutions is now within your reaches, ready for you to check out and conquer. Appreciate the journey!